Greater than 1,000,000 KBC and Ulster Financial institution prospects face chaos as they attempt to change accounts whereas the 2 establishments go away Eire.
eople in search of a brand new financial institution are being blocked from opening a bank card account and getting an overdraft facility.
The Central Financial institution has been urged to “get its finger out” and do extra to cease the closures turning right into a “catastrophe”.
Clients making use of for an overdraft or a card with a brand new financial institution are encountering lengthy delays as they should bear credit score worthiness assessments. Many are prone to be refused.
In lots of instances, these wanting an in-person appointment are being given a date weeks and typically months away.
The common buyer has as much as 10 direct debits and standing orders a month, which they must switch individually to a different financial institution.
Michael Kilcoyne, the chairman of the Shoppers’ Affiliation of Eire, stated the huge shut-down of accounts was turning into “chaos” and urged the Central Financial institution to intervene.
“Obstacles are being put in the best way of customers opening new accounts and the regulator must step in,” he stated.
These in search of to switch to a financial institution the place they’ll avail of an overdraft must have operated their new account for 3 months earlier than they’ll even apply.
Banks have failed to rent sufficient further workers to deal with the huge demand for accounts.
Ready instances when phoning a financial institution have grown frustratingly lengthy.
Round seven million separate direct debits, recurring card funds and credit score transfers could possibly be impacted by the mass motion of consumers to new suppliers.
Three million different transactions are impacted by the motion of enterprise accounts, banking sources stated.
The method to amend direct debits is manually intensive and depending on the earlier financial institution issuing letters to every direct debit originator to vary the main points.
It’s then depending on every direct debit originator accepting and finishing the instruction.
Labour Celebration finance spokesman Ged Nash stated: “This has the potential to be catastrophic if not dealt with correctly.
“The Central Financial institution wants to face up for customers.”
The Central Financial institution denied it was failing to supply management on the exits of the 2 banks.
“We’re carefully monitoring compliance with the expectations we’ve set and we’re ready to intervene additional, if crucial, ought to this transition not proceed according to these expectations,” a spokesperson stated.
Central Financial institution governor Gabriel Makhlouf conceded just lately that the present banks and people that may stay will not be solely prepared for what is ready to be their greatest logistical problem because the introduction of the euro.
KBC Financial institution will start writing to its 130,000 present account prospects from June, however will give them solely 90 days to change.
Ulster Financial institution has 360,000 lively private present accounts within the Republic, 300,000 lively deposit accounts and 70,000 enterprise accounts.
